Northrop Grumman Aerospace Systems has an opening for a Sr. Mechanical Design Engineer to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als. This position will be located in Melbourne, FL.

The selected candidate will contribute in the research, design, analysis, manufacture, and testing associated with aircraft Support Equipment.

Key Responsibilities
  • Mechanical design of test, measurement, and handling equipment used on military aircraft.
  • Gathering data, requirements development, interfacing with suppliers, and performing basic stress and tolerance analysis
  • Acting as manufacturing liaison during build process of your project to ensure overall quality, delivery, and cost objectives are achieved
  • Development of test plans and performing environmental testing of Support Equipment
  • Testing and integration of manufactured Support Equipment on aircraft
  • Basic knowledge of design and analysis tools for mechanical design as well as basic drafting skills to include a working knowledge of solid modeling techniques (NX, Pro Engineer, or Catia).
  • The selected candidate should thrive in a fast-paced work environment with high expectations, significantly diverse assignments, and collaborative/team settings across all levels.
  • Candidate must also be willing to occasionally travel to various site locations to demonstrate the function of the designed Support Equipment.
Basic Qualifications
  • Must have a Bachelors degree in a STEM field and at least 8 years of relevant military / professional experience, OR a Master's Degree in a STEM field and at least 6 years of relevant military / professional experience, OR a PhD and at least 4 years of relevant military / professional experience
  • Experience using CAD software in generating detailed engineering drawings used for manufacturing mechanical and/or electrical assemblies
  • Ability to obtain a U.S. Government Secret clearance or higher security clearance
Preferred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Mechanical Engineering
  • experience in the design of mechanical and/or electro-mechanical subsystems
  • Current, active in-scope U.S. Government Secret or higher security clearance
  • Ability to obtain additional Special Access Program (SAP) access
  • Experience using FEA software in performance of stress analysis of mechanical and/or electrical assemblies to include static and dynamic analysis to MIL-STD-810 requirements
  • FAA A&P Certificate or equivalent aircraft maintenance background
  • Experience developing manufacturing drawings to GD&T standards
